Output 342d065d1f9bb94e307f42208fd76bed8eef2056f998300c536fb16fc58af0ef:0

value
905276
script pubkey
OP_0 OP_PUSHBYTES_20 c25ca55f4795b838d5226ec7da559b948a5a6924
address
bc1qcfw22h68jkur34fzdmra54vmjj9956fyvevaex
transaction
342d065d1f9bb94e307f42208fd76bed8eef2056f998300c536fb16fc58af0ef
confirmations
159062
spent
true